1How to port a serial driver to driver model
2===========================================
3
4About 16 of 33 serial drivers have been converted as at September 2015. It
5is time for maintainers to start converting over the remaining serial drivers:
6

26Here is a suggested approach for converting your serial driver over to driver
27model. Please feel free to update this file with your ideas and suggestions.
28
29- #ifdef out all your own serial driver code (#ifndef CONFIG_DM_SERIAL)
30- Define CONFIG_DM_SERIAL for your board, vendor or architecture
31- If the board does not already use driver model, you need CONFIG_DM also
32- Your board should then build, but will not boot since there will be no serial
33 driver
34- Add the U_BOOT_DRIVER piece at the end (e.g. copy serial_s5p.c for example)
35- Add a private struct for the driver data - avoid using static variables
36- Implement each of the driver methods, perhaps by calling your old methods
37- You may need to adjust the function parameters so that the old and new
38 implementations can share most of the existing code
39- If you convert all existing users of the driver, remove the pre-driver-model
40 code
41
42In terms of patches a conversion series typically has these patches:
43- clean up / prepare the driver for conversion
44- add driver model code
45- convert at least one existing board to use driver model serial
46- (if no boards remain that don't use driver model) remove the old code
47
48This may be a good time to move your board to use device tree also. Mostly
49this involves these steps:
50
51- define CONFIG_OF_CONTROL and CONFIG_OF_SEPARATE
52- add your device tree files to arch/<arch>/dts
53- update the Makefile there
54- Add stdout-path to your /chosen device tree node if it is not already there
55- build and get u-boot-dtb.bin so you can test it
56- Your drivers can now use device tree
57- For device tree in SPL, define CONFIG_SPL_OF_CONTROL
